9th Grade AP English Literature introduces students to college-level literary analysis, requiring them to read complex texts and write sophisticated essays interpreting themes, symbolism, and author's craft. The challenge lies in balancing close reading skills with timed writing—students must analyze passages quickly while constructing well-organized arguments, which is a significant jump from standard 9th-grade English coursework.

The biggest challenges are managing reading comprehension under time pressure, moving beyond surface-level analysis to identify deeper themes and symbolism, and organizing thoughts into coherent essays quickly. Many students also struggle with understanding question formats—knowing whether to focus on literary devices, character motivation, or thematic analysis—and managing test anxiety when faced with unfamiliar texts.
Tutors teach strategic essay frameworks that work across different prompts, helping you outline quickly, develop strong thesis statements, and support claims with specific textual evidence. Through practice with timed writing sessions and feedback on your drafts, you'll build muscle memory for organizing ideas efficiently and writing with the sophistication expected at the AP level.
Yes—practice tests are essential for AP English Literature success. Most tutors recommend taking full-length practice exams every 2-3 weeks to build stamina and identify weak areas, then using shorter practice passages between sessions to refine specific skills. Your tutor can help you analyze which questions you're missing and why, so you're not just practicing but learning from each attempt.
Personalized tutoring reduces anxiety by building genuine competence—when you've practiced similar questions dozens of times and received detailed feedback, unfamiliar texts feel less intimidating. Tutors also teach test-day strategies like pacing techniques, how to approach difficult passages, and confidence-building routines that help you stay focused and calm during the actual exam.
